About The Position

The Junior Data Engineer supports the design, development, and maintenance of data pipelines and infrastructure that enable efficient data ingestion, processing, and storage within a regulated enterprise environment. The role focuses on building scalable data workflows, implementing transformation logic, and ensuring data quality and integrity across mission‑critical systems for analytics and reporting. The engineer collaborates with analysts, data scientists, and security teams to deliver reliable datasets, contribute to data governance and lineage tracking, and drive continuous improvement of data platform performance and reliability.

Responsibilities

  • Develop, operate, and maintain automated ETL/ELT pipelines using tools such as Python, SQL, or Spark to process structured and unstructured data across enterprise data platforms.
  • Implement data models, schemas, and storage solutions in relational and non‑relational databases, including data lakes and data warehouses, to support analytics and reporting requirements.
  • Apply data quality validation techniques, including anomaly detection, schema enforcement, and automated testing frameworks, to ensure accuracy, completeness, and consistency of data.
  • Support orchestration and scheduling of data pipelines using workflow managers such as Apache Airflow or similar tools, ensuring reliable, repeatable execution.
  • Optimize data processing performance through indexing, partitioning, and distributed computing approaches to meet latency and throughput targets.
  • Implement data security controls, including encryption, access management, and adherence to applicable federal data protection standards, in coordination with security teams.
  • Track and document data lineage and metadata in support of data governance, auditability, and regulatory reporting expectations.
  • Troubleshoot pipeline failures, latency issues, and data inconsistencies across integrated systems, coordinating with cross‑functional teams to resolve root causes.
  • Collaborate with data scientists, analysts, and business stakeholders to translate analytics requirements into scalable, maintainable data solutions and improvements to the data platform.
